Top Knobs Asbury Series pull is a brushed satin nickel cabinet handle designed for use on kitchen and bath cabinets. The Asbury collection is described as creating a welcoming ambiance that complements both traditional and contemporary styles, so this pull supports projects that bridge classic cabinet profiles and cleaner modern fronts in the same room. The collection's lean designs in brushed or polished nickel bring a crisp look to any home, so the straight square bar form of this pull helps doors and drawers read clean and aligned across a run. The 12-5/8 inch, or 320 mm, center to center sizing gives a long gripping span, which helps doors and larger drawers open with a comfortable hand position. The brushed satin nickel finish tones down reflections, which helps finger marks show less on frequently used cabinet fronts.
